Step 1
~8 min

Roast the pumpkin, sunflower, and flax seeds in a dry frying pan over medium heat until they begin to crackle and become fragrant. This should take about 5-7 minutes.

Step 2
~8 min

Transfer the roasted seeds to a large mixing bowl and let them cool slightly.

Step 3
~8 min

Add the bread flour, wheat bran, instant yeast, and sea salt to the bowl with the cooled seeds. Mix well to combine the dry ingredients.

Step 4
~8 min

In a separate bowl, combine the honey, buttermilk, and 3/4 cup of water.

Step 5
~8 min

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until a shaggy dough forms.

Step 6
~8 min

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face.

Step 7
~8 min

Knead the dough for 10-12 minutes, adding up to 1/4 cup of water if needed, until it becomes elastic and smooth, but not sticky.

Step 8
~8 min

Place the dough in a clean, lightly oiled bowl and cover with plastic wrap.

Step 9
~8 min

Let the dough rise in a warm place for 1 hour, or until it has doubled in size.

Step 10
~8 min

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 11
~8 min

Divide the risen dough into two equal portions.

Step 12
~8 min

Shape each portion into a cylinder and place them into greased 4x8-inch or 5x10-inch loaf pans.

Step 13
~8 min

Cover the loaf pans and let the dough rise again until it has doubled in size, approximately 45 minutes to 1 hour.

Step 14
~8 min

Bake the loaves in the preheated oven for 50-60 minutes, or until the bottom of a loaf sounds hollow when tapped.

Step 15
~8 min

Remove the baked bread from the oven and let them cool in the pans for 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
